Terpenoids.The most common and structurally varied natural compounds present in many plants are isoprenoids, often known as terpenoids. Depending on how many carbon atoms they contain, terpenoids are classified as monoterpenes, sesquiterpenes, diterpenes, sesterpenes, and triterpenes. This class of chemicals exhibits a wide range of extremely significant pharmacological effects in the battle against cancer, malaria, inflammation, and a variety of infectious disorders, according to numerous in vitro, preclinical, and clinical studies. Terpenoids that are found in nature offer new chances to develop medications with fewer negative effects.
